What should I do with my old roof after replacement?

Most roofing contractors include the disposal of old roofing materials in their quotes. They will typically haul the debris to a landfill or a recycling center, depending on local regulations and the materials. You can inquire about recycling options and environmentally friendly disposal practices.

What should I do if my roof is damaged in a storm?

If your roof suffers damage during a storm:
  1. Safety First: Avoid going onto the roof during a storm, as it's dangerous.
  2. Document the Damage: Take photos and videos of the damage for insurance purposes.
  3. Contact Your Insurance Company: Report the damage to your insurance company as soon as possible to initiate a claim.
  4. Temporary Repairs: If safe, address any immediate leaks using buckets or tarps to minimize further damage.
  5. Contact a Roofing Contractor: After the storm, have a qualified roofing contractor inspect the roof and provide a repair estimate.

What are the different types of roofing materials?

Common roofing materials include:
  • Asphalt Shingles: Popular, affordable, available in various styles (3-tab, architectural, etc.)
  • Metal Roofing: Durable, long-lasting, energy-efficient, available in panels, shingles, or tiles.
  • Tile Roofing: Clay, concrete, or slate; known for longevity, durability, and aesthetic appeal.
  • Flat Roofing: EPDM rubber, TPO, PVC, modified bitumen, or built-up roofing (BUR).
  • Slate: Natural stone, extremely durable, expensive, requires expert installation.
  • Wood Shakes or Shingles: Natural wood, aesthetically pleasing, requires regular maintenance.
The best material for your roof depends on your budget, climate, and aesthetic preferences.

What is the difference between a roofer and a general contractor?

While both can be involved in construction projects, they specialize in different areas:
Roofer: Specializes in roof installations, repairs, and replacements. They have expertise in roofing materials, techniques, and safety practices specific to roofing.
General Contractor: Oversees and manages entire construction projects, including hiring and coordinating subcontractors, such as roofers, electricians, plumbers, etc. They handle overall project planning, scheduling, and budgeting.
For roofing projects, it's generally best to hire a roofing contractor who specializes in roof work.
